Learn all about America’s favorite breed, the Labrador Retriever!
About Sue Willumsen: Sue works in veterinary medicine and got her first Labrador in 1980. She has been very involved in the dog world ever since, showing and competing with her dogs. She is an AKC-licensed judge in several breeds.
About Barbara Gilchrist: Barbara got her first Labrador in 1964. As the dog was rather difficult, Barbara focused on getting involved in obedience with her. She was then the first woman to be hired at a local field trial kennel, for which she dropped out of college to work for. She’s been very involved ever since, breeding many champions along the way.
About Susan Patterson: Susan is a renowned Labrador Retriever breeder and breeds under the Fenwyck Labrador Retriever name. She has been breeding since the 80's when she first got involved with various Labrador Retriever clubs.
The experts discuss how the Labrador hunts in the field, and why its structure as defined by the breed standard is so important.
They talk about the differences between specialty dogs and show dogs. The type of hunting that takes place now is very different from the hunting that took place 50 years ago, which results in different types of Labs built for different purposes.
